Application and Service MonitoringAggreGate Network manager helps companies to ensure high availability and performance for their business applications. The system "knows" common applications, services, technologies and protocols, and uses intelligent monitoring technology for checking operability of business-critical systems. In addition to native monitoring of networked applications, the Network Manager obtains information about processes running on remote machines via SNMP. The Network Manager supports batch configuration of application monitors for several hosts, along with replication and export/import of monitoring settings. Service Status Dashboards
Services status dashboard provide a very easy way to get an overall picture of your IT infrastructure health. It shows a matrix of servers and services indicating state of every service by color-coding. Service status dashboard is a nodal point for finding the root cause of diverse network problems. Application Problem AlertingAggreGate Network Manager provides out-of-the-box alerts for typical application problems, such as Apache Web Server Requests Overload or FTP Out Of Disk Space. Application/Service Discovery
The network discovery process finds both known and unrecognized ("generic") services by TCP/UDP port scanning. If an active service is detected, its monitoring is auto-enabled when a device account is created for the host. The system also finds and applies an optimal monitoring profile for every service. Message and Error AggregationThe network manager remotely collects application messages and error notifications via Syslog and Windows Event Log facilities. These messages are stored in the central server database for maintaining long-term audit trails. Received application errors may be broarcasted using Syslog and SNMP traps. Any application error may trigger an alert, causing email/SMS system administrator notifications and automatic corrective actions (server rebooting, remote script execution, etc.) Web Server and Website MonitoringRound-the-clock supervising of your website is crucial for proactive identification of problems before they escalate into substantial downtime and lost revenue.

Database Monitoring
AggreGate Network Manager monitors database servers via JDBC/ODBC. Most modern enterprise databases are supported, including Oracle, Microsoft SQL Server, MySQL, PostreSQL, Firebird, etc. The network manager checks server availability, executes custom queries and matches query results against specific criteria (field/row count, field values, etc.) Generic TCP/UDP Port MonitoringOperability of network applications and services (both TCP and UDP) that are not natively supported is ensured by:
